Subject: Handover — template rendering performance

As of next sprint, ownership of the template rendering performance workstream in Glimmerforge is changing hands. Review requests for the partial-caching refactor and the benchmark suite should be routed to the new owner rather than the previous maintainer. Open review threads will be migrated this week; nothing else changes in the review workflow. The new owner is listed below.

account owner for bawip-tahag: Raleth Quenok

Handover for the Tillhook barcode integration. The scanner bridge polls the Zebraline SDK over serial, normalizes symbologies, and pushes events to the inventory queue. Known issue: duplicate scans within 200ms are debounced in the bridge, not the SDK, so don't remove that logic. Firmware updates require a queue drain first. Full wiring diagrams and the debounce rationale live on the internal page here.

wiki page, tahaf-tajog: https://jira.ordindyn.corp/pipeline

- [ ] Step 7: Archive cold storage buckets (Glacierline tier). Confirm both ceremony witnesses are present, verify bucket manifests match the Oxbow ledger, then seal the archive key shares. Plugin authors may observe but not handle shares. Once sealed, the archive index itself is encrypted and can only be reopened with the passphrase below.

vault phrase of badup-hahig = tamael-aldael-kelmir-istael-fenok-istwyn-tamius-jorath-oliion

## Releases

CrashFunnel pipeline releases ship weekly. Bump the version, run the symbolication tests against the Osterby fixture dumps, and confirm the ingest worker drains the backlog queue cleanly. Build the container, tag it, push to staging. Verify one synthetic crash round-trips end to end. Production deploys are gated on a signed manifest; generate it last. Sign the manifest with the key below.

release key, hadug-kawef: bky13_mPGeFZeR1GZ1G